Martin and Roman Kemp to explore the island of Ireland in ‘spooky’ road-trip, in new Channel 4 series

Tourism Ireland welcomes new travelogue TV series set to air across Britain later this year

Celebrity father-and-son duo Martin and Roman Kemp are on the island of Ireland this week, filming for a brand-new, three-part TV series. The programme is set to air later this year on Channel 4 and is co-produced by Tourism Ireland. 

Produced by Rock Oyster Media, the series follows the popular pair as they delve into Ireland’s spooky myths, ghost, banshees and legends, exploring how ancient traditions have evolved into modern day experiences and festivals. This trip is all about Martin and Roman diving in together – from coasteering on the dramatic Causeway Coast, to trying their hand at hurling, playing the uilleann pipes and experiencing storytelling in a traditional Irish pub.

The duo will travel the length of the island, through Antrim, Derry-Londonderry, Tyrone, Cork, Dublin, Kildare and Meath. Along the way they will meet the characters, try the challenges and share the kind of adventure you only get when you’re exploring with someone who knows you inside out! It will see them discover the island of Ireland like they’ve never seen it before – through sport, music and customs that have shaped the island for centuries.   

Judith Cassidy, Tourism Ireland's Acting Head of Great Britain, said: “We are delighted to welcome Martin and Roman Kemp to Ireland, to film all about the ancient stories and traditions that make this island unique. Their journey will highlight our stunning scenery and rich heritage, capturing viewers’ imaginations and inspiring them to come and explore the island of Ireland for their next holiday.”

Publicity and broadcasts like this are a key element of Tourism Ireland’s programme of promotional activity, to encourage travellers in Britain, and elsewhere around the world, to put the island of Ireland on their holiday wish-list.

Notes to Editors:

  • Tourism Ireland is the organisation responsible for promoting the island of Ireland overseas as a leading holiday destination.
  • In 2024, overseas visitor spend grew by +9% on 2023, bringing €6.9 billion to the island of Ireland.
  • Tourism Ireland’s international website is www.ireland.com, with 21 market sites available in 18 different countries, as well as one international site, in seven language versions around the world.
  • Tourism Ireland is an agency of the Department of Enterprise, Tourism and Employment in Ireland and the Department for the Economy in Northern Ireland.
